I'm looking at that now. The only comment / request I have right now is
about atftp. It was on my list of stuff to update and move into
meta-networking. If there's no objection it that, would you mind moving
it there at the same time? I'd been planning to have it in
meta-networking/recipes-daemons.

> >> +Fate #303031: Circumvent TFTP size restrictions in atftpd
> >> +The size of a single image file that can be transferred with TFTP is limited to
> >> +2^(2*8) *BLOCKSIZE (as per RFC 1350 there are only two bytes for the block
> >> +counter). This is problematic for one of our customers who needs to transfer
> >> +100+ MB Windows images using a TFTP client (NT bootloader) which has a
> >> +hardwared BLOCKSIZE setting of 1432).
